A pleasant - though often very windy - place to take a walk! Not the most attractive of esplanades - it could do with some nicely painted railings like the ones in Largs, Gourock or Greenock. There are views across the Clyde towards the island of Arran.
In warm sunny weather you'll often find families playing and picnicking on the lovely broad sandy beach. There's a putting green, children's play area and toilets and it's not far to the town's shops, cafes and restaurants. It's also a popular beach for windsurfing and a bit of fishing. The Sailing Club is found where the Esplanade meets Grangemuir Road.
You'll find a free car park at the north end beside the golf course, and a second further down the Esplanade, but there are usually plenty of places where you can park all along the seafront.
